Maxim 4-40 V, 50 mA LDO regulators feature low quiescent current

Maxim Integrated Products has introduced the MAX15006/MAX15007, high-voltage, low-dropout (LDO) linear regulators for “always-on” automotive applications such as remote keyless entry (RKE), receiver modules for tire pressure monitoring, and power-supply modules for "keep-alive" circuits.

Both devices offer 90 µA typical quiescent current with a 50 mA load and 10 µA at no load. The MAX15007 draws just 3 µA in shutdown. The devices can operate from a cold-crank voltage as low as 4 V and withstand load-dump transients as high as 45 V. Both deliver up to 50 mA of output current. The MAX15006/MAX15007 both include short-circuit protection. The output of each regulator can be shorted to ground for an indefinite duration even with an input voltage as high as 40 V.

Both devices include thermal shutdown to protect them from excessive temperatures at the die. The MAX15006/MAX15007 are specified for operation over the -40 °C to +125 °C and are available in 3.3 V or 5 V output versions. They are packaged in a 3 mm x 3 mm, thermally enhanced 6-pin TDFN or a thermally enhanced 8-pin SO with 1.9 W and 1.86 W dissipation respectively at an ambient temperature of 70 °C.
